How Our Attic Water Damage Restoration Process Works
When you call us for Attic Water Damage Restoration, you can expect a thorough and efficient process that focuses on your safety and your home’s integrity. Our team will assess the damage, develop a customized plan, and execute it with precision and care. We’ll work closely with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process.
Step 1: Assessment and Documentation
Our team will arrive at your home within 60 minutes to assess the damage and document the affected areas. We’ll take photos and notes to support your insurance claim and provide a clear understanding of the work required. We’ll work with you to identify the source of the water damage and develop a plan to prevent future incidents.
Step 2: Equipment Setup and Drying
We’ll set up specialized equipment to dry out your attic, including dehumidifiers, fans, and air movers. Our technicians will work tirelessly to remove excess moisture and prevent further damage. We’ll monitor the drying process to ensure it’s done correctly and efficiently.
Step 3: Cleaning and Disinfecting
Once the drying process is complete, we’ll clean and disinfect the affected areas to prevent mold and mildew growth. Our team will use eco-friendly products and equipment to ensure a safe and healthy environment. We’ll also remove any affected insulation and debris.
Step 4: Repair and Reconstruction
Finally, we’ll repair and reconstruct any damaged areas, including drywall, insulation, and roofing. Our team will work with you to select materials and finishes that match your home’s original style and design. We’ll also provide guidance on how to prevent future water damage.

Attic Water Damage Restoration Cost in Sheffield, OH
The cost of Attic Water Damage Restoration in Sheffield, OH can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Documentation | $100 – $500 | Size and complexity of the affected area, number of affected rooms |
| Equipment Setup and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size and complexity of the affected area, number of affected rooms, type of equipment used |
| Cleaning and Disinfecting | $200 – $1,000 | Size and complexity of the affected area, type of materials affected |
| Repair and Re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size and complexity of the affected area, type of materials affected, number of affected rooms |

Common Questions About Attic Water Damage Restoration
Q: How long does it take to dry out an attic after a flood?
A: The drying process typically takes 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the flood and the effectiveness of our equipment. We’ll work closely with you to ensure the area is dry and safe before reconstruction begins.
Q: Can I use a DIY dehumidifier to dry out my attic?
A: While DIY dehumidifiers can help, they may not be enough to fully dry out your attic. Our team uses specialized equipment and techniques to ensure a thorough and efficient drying process.
Q: How do I prevent water damage in my attic?
A: Regular inspections, proper ventilation, and prompt repairs can help prevent water damage in your attic. We’ll provide guidance on how to maintain your home and prevent future incidents.
